| | Sony PS-LX300USB Stereo Turntable | | 2008-03-15 03:58:00 | | The PS-LX300USB USB Stereo Turntable from Sony allows you to transfer music from Vinyl Records to your PC, iPod or portable music player. Supporting a USB interface and Audio Studio software, the process of bringing your Vinyl albums to the digital world is made easy.This device can also operate as a fully functional turntable, allowing you to playback Vinyl albums through your sound system. A moving magnet phonograph cartridge and built in phonograph preamp provide compatibility with AV receivers without a phonograph input. A belt drive system is used for rotational stability and reduced motor noise.The Sony PS-LX300USB Stereo Turntable will be available from March 2008. | | Car Stereo Installation Guide part 3 | | 2008-02-20 09:16:48 | | Installing the new stereo If the original stereo was bolted into the dash, you might need to remove the mounting brackets from the sides of it and attach them to the sides of your new stereo. More likely, you will need a mounting kit (which may include a trim ring, a dash insert, brackets, a faceplate, and/or a metal mounting sleeve) to install the stereo (Figure 1).If a mounting kit is required, install it first. Then slide the new stereo's metal mounting sleeve (if included) into the kit. Secure the metal sleeve by using a screwdriver to bend the sleeve's metal tabs into place (Figure 2).Once the dash opening is ready for the new stereo, hold the stereo near the opening. Connect the stereo wiring adapter to the vehicle's wiring harness and plug in the antenna cable.Slide the stereo into the dash opening, but don't fasten it down just yet. | | Car Stereo Installation Guide part 2 | | 2008-02-20 09:14:23 | | Prepping the new stereo If Crutchfield carries a custom wiring harness for your vehicle, you can use it to connect your new stereo to your vehicle's factory wiring harnesses. This will ensure that everything works seamlessly, just like the factory stereo did. If a harness is not available for your vehicle or if the factory stereo plug was cut off, you'll need to identify each of the stereo wires and connect them to the corresponding wires of your new stereo. If you purchased your new stereo from Crutchfield, our Tech Department may be able to tell you the colors and functions of your car's stereo wires.Crimping and SolderingDecide whether you want to crimp or solder the wires together. Crimping is faster and easier. If you crimp the wires together, be sure to use the correct size crimp connector — typical in-dash stereo wires are 18-gauge, but a few use heavier gauge power and ground wires. | | Things to look for when buying car stereo speakers. | | 2007-07-09 19:34:00 | | By Roger Charles 1. How is the speaker's power measured?Pay close attention to the amount of power the speaker can handle. This is particularly important when dealing with woofers, since they require more power to play loudly. Look out for models where the manufacturers exaggerate power. Ensure that power is measures in RMS. Be very wary of terms like "music power" and "peak power". These terms mean nothing when it comes to measuring power.2. How sensitive is the speaker?The more sensitive a speaker is, the less power required to play it. If a speaker is insensitive it will require a lot more power to play at the same volume. If you're using an amplifier you don't have much to worry about. But sensitivity becomes a bigger issue when you're using your head unit to power your speakers.
